Q: Is 115,888,118 a Prime Number?
A: No, 115,888,118 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 115888118 can be evenly divided by 1 2 29 58 841 1,682 68,899 137,798 1,998,071 3,996,142 57,944,059 and 115,888,118, with no remainder.
Since 115,888,118 cannot be divided by just 1 and 115,888,118, it is not a prime number.
